Supermarkets no longer selling cheapest fuel, RAC says
Research by the RAC showed that independent fuel retailers were cheaper than supermarkets
The British Retail Consortium said "retailers had reduced petrol prices significantly" in recent months. "Now, because of the cost of living crisis, that seems to have changed, and drivers are becoming more cost conscious." He added that supermarkets now seemed to be more concerned with grocery sales than "getting people onto forecourts" which has given more of an opportunity for independent petrol stations., as wholesale prices had fallen significantly.
"Small retailers may have made a deal with the petrol companies to sell their fuel at a lower level."
